Re: Android running on US Cellular data service **Solved for most***

Quote:
Originally Posted by nasaman2000 View Post
Ya... I wish it was that easy. On my phone I dont have any APN Settings to change. Im not really sure why. From what everyone has said... It should be in the /settings/Wireless & Networks/Mobile networks/ but all I have there is Data Roaming & System Select options. Agian... I have a Motorola A855 Droid with 2.0.1 Rom. I have used two different roms and neither have the setting in the mobile networks option. Am I going to the wrong place? And yes... I have the phone programmed correctly in the ##PROGRAM settings. I used my old HTC Touch Pro 2 to set everything in the NAM settings menu but there is no Username and Password option in there either. P.S. I have the phone working to send and receive calls and txt as well.
Have you tried to go into the PST settings? From what I am reading this might be the same as WinMo.

Dial ##778 (##PST). Password is still 000000

Go to Security.
HDR AN AUTH user Id (LONG): ESN_Hex@uscc.net (Get this from the display page)
HDR AN AUTH Password (LONG): ESN_hex
PPP USER ID: yourMSID@uscc.net
PPP PASSWORD: yourMSID



Go to M.IP Settings.
Number of Profiles: 6
Active User Profile Index: 0
MIP_MODE: Mobile IP Preferred
MIP Registration Retries: 1
MIP Registration Retry Timeout: 2000 ms
MIP Pre-Registration Timeout: 3
Mobile Node-HA Authentication: Enable
Send a Registration Request Only in Use: Enable
Dormant Handoff Optimization: Enable

Re: Android running on US Cellular data service **Solved for most***

alright, not sure if this is fixed or not, but i've been combing through all the search results here, and on xda. i have yet to find a solid US Cellular fix.

i have tried EVERY option given in this thread from syntax, cliff, and eval and haven't been successful with any attempt. i have no idea how many times i've rebooted my phone.

BUT i now have mms working where i can SEND MMS messages, but not receive - and i NEED to be able to receive MMS.

after trying the .sh files i was ready to give up until i tried a combination of things and went into winmo to get the APN address listed there and it showed "U.S. Cellular" as the name and "internet" as the actual APN, i then went:

Settings>Wireless & Networks>Mobile Networks>Access Point Names:

Name: U.S. Cellular
APN: internet
Proxy: <not set>
Port 80
Username: MSID@mms.uscc.net (i only used this since it's the address i send images to from my email for work)
Password: MSID
Server: <not set>
MMSC: http://mmsc1.uscc.net/mmsc/MMS
MMS Proxy: <not set>
MMS port: 80
MCC: 310
MNC: 995
Authentication Type: PAP or CHAP
APN Type: <not set>


now i'm not sure if this helps anyone at all, and i have no idea if this issue has been solved, but please someone help me out here and point me in the right direction if it has been solved or what changes i need to make to get this to actually work
